EasyCVR安防监控平台运行卡顿及响应缓慢的原因排查和解决

近期有用户反馈,EasyCVR视频监控平台在运行过程中出现卡顿及响应缓慢现象。为尽快解决这一问题,我们立即安排技术人员进行排查。

1、现场排查过程

技术人员拿到现场后,立即对服务器进行了全面检查,重点关注磁盘空间与读写性能。通过系统工具(Linux系统使用iostat命令,Windows系统使用任务管理器)查看磁盘使用率,发现磁盘使用速率较高,这可能是导致平台卡顿及响应缓慢的直接原因。

进一步排查发现,由于磁盘使用速率过高,导致SQLite数据库锁死,从而影响了平台的正常运行。

2、问题原因分析

经过深入分析,我们推测问题的根本原因在于平台配置中启用了HLS流功能。HLS流在运行过程中会产生大量磁盘读写操作,当磁盘性能无法满足需求时,就会导致磁盘使用速率过高,进而引发SQLite数据库锁死,最终导致平台卡顿及响应缓慢。

3、解决办法

1)调整平台配置

登录平台,点击导航栏中的【配置】选项,进入【播放配置】页面。在“播放协议”栏中,将HLS流功能关闭(取消勾选)。此操作可有效降低磁盘读写速率,减轻磁盘负担。

2)优化磁盘性能(可选)

如果后续仍有磁盘性能瓶颈,建议定期清理磁盘空间,优化磁盘碎片,并根据实际需求考虑升级服务器硬件配置,以进一步提升平台运行效率。

4、整改效果

经过上述操作,平台运行恢复正常,卡顿及响应缓慢现象已完全消除。后续我们将持续关注平台运行状态,确保其稳定运行。